Originally Posted by Lexatlast
Pwidow, i'm not gonna lie, i've looked at these pictures about 10 times today and i take in a deep breath and pull my stomach in every time i see that clearance... jesus, its sooo close. Did you know it would be that close? and is the clearance that tiny on the rears as well? can't tell from the pics.

and lastly, if the offset were +38-+40 in the front, do you know if the brakes fit?
Yes I actually did know they were going to be that close, that was the hold up for a few weeks till I decided what to do. When I test fit them, they didn't work so I even thought about getting new wheels at the time, but I had to make them work So I had to grind on the caliper just a little bit and then use a 3/16" spacer and then get extended studs to make everything work. No the rears bolted on with no problem and I still have probably about 1" gap between the wheel and the caliper.

And like mkiiisupra said, it will all depend on the wheel. The way my spokes are curved made them not work...at first
